Abstract Introduction Anti-Melanoma Differentiation-Associated Gene 5 (MDA-5) antibody-positive dermatomyositis (MDA5-DM) is a distinct subtype of idiopathic inflammatory myopathy characterized by high mortality due to rapidly progressive interstitial lung disease (RP-ILD). This case illustrates the diagnostic challenges and therapeutic dilemmas in managing refractory MDA5-DM in an elderly patient. Case Description A 75-year-old female presented with cough, fever, and dyspnea. Physical examination revealed tachypnea (38 breaths/min) and hypoxemia (SpO2 88-90% on 3L/min O2). Laboratory studies showed elevated inflammatory markers (CRP 43.2 mg/L, ESR 101 mm/h) and muscle enzymes (CK 370 U/L, LDH 402 U/L). Arterial blood gas analysis demonstrated type I respiratory failure (PaO2/FiO2 175.7). Chest computed tomography (CT) revealed bilateral ground-glass opacities with lower lung predominance. Anti-MDA5 antibodies were confirmed with a titer of 1:100. Despite initial management with meropenem and high-flow nasal oxygen, she developed progressive hypoxemia requiring intubation on day 4. Transfer to the Emergency Intensive Care Unit (EICU) prompted veno-venous extracorporeal membrane oxygenation (V-V ECMO) initiation. Autoimmune serology confirmed the MDA5-DM diagnosis, leading to treatment with methylprednisolone 500 mg daily, plasma exchange, and high-dose intravenous immunoglobulin (IVIG) pulse therapy. The subsequent course was complicated by polymicrobial infections (A. baumannii, S. haemolyticus, fungi) and coagulopathy. Despite broad-spectrum antimicrobials and intensified immunosuppression with mycophenolate mofetil and upadacitinib, she developed pneumothorax on day 18 and ultimately succumbed to respiratory-circulatory collapse on day 24. Discussion This case exemplifies three critical aspects of MDA5-DM management: First, the diagnostic challenge of distinguishing RP-ILD from infectious pneumonitis, particularly with non-specific initial presentation; Second, the precarious balance between aggressive immunosuppression and infection risk—our patient developed lethal opportunistic infections despite microbiological control; Third, the limited efficacy of conventional and rescue therapies (including V-V ECMO and plasma exchange) in end-stage disease. The rapid progression from diagnosis to mortality (24 days) despite multimodal therapy underscores the therapeutic recalcitrance in elderly MDA5-DM patients. This highlights the need for earlier detection strategies and novel treatment approaches for this devastating disease. This abstract is funded by: None
